    You'll notice that at the state cup and the regions at U16 - U18 the big name clubs across the country are absent because they all have USSF DA programs. U15 is generally it, last hurrah.

    If Eclipse stays together, the competition they'll have to play against will be lessened by 66 (+/-) clubs around the country including in Chicago Magic/Fire/Sockers.

    Nice team, they'll decide what are the most important aspects to them.
